wptelegrampro\WPTelegramPro D

Total Complexity 217
Dependencies 6
Dependents 1
Total lines 1,212
Lines of code 922
Logical lines of code 501
Comment lines 110
Methods 57
Properties 18

Methods 57

Method Rating Maintainability Complexity Lines of code
query()
C
31 24 105
set_user()
A
42 15 50
keyboard_columns()
A
54 13 19
check_user_id()
A
50 11 25
disconnect_telegram_wp_user()
S
53 7 22
dropdown_categories()
S
52 7 22
update_user()
S
56 7 17
settings()
S
45 5 43
connect_telegram_wp_user()
S
55 6 19
get_users()
S
50 5 30
get_tax_keyboard()
S
51 5 27
helps_command_list()
S
49 4 37
image_size_select()
S
55 5 16
get_user_role()
S
60 5 13
init()
S
61 5 11
get_image_sizes()
S
54 4 21
__construct()
S
46 3 34
post_type_select()
S
49 3 32
get_user_random_code()
S
59 4 15
get_taxonomy_terms()
S
59 4 14
change_user_status()
S
58 3 15
install()
S
52 2 29
wp_user_random_code()
S
60 3 13
fix_post_info()
S
61 3 12
random_id()
S
61 3 12
get_bot_info()
S
62 3 11
words()
S
47 1 35
get_bot_connect_link()
S
63 3 10
get_bot_disconnect_link()
S
62 3 10
check_remote_post()
S
64 3 8
wp_user_roles()
S
63 3 10
update_user_meta()
S
64 3 9
check_plugin_active()
S
67 3 7
fix_telegram_text()
S
68 3 7
getInstance()
S
66 3 8
get_user_meta()
S
64 3 10
plugin_action_links()
S
60 2 13
add_every_minutes()
S
61 2 11
enqueue_scripts()
S
54 1 20
about_settings_content()
S
60 1 18
message()
S
77 2 3
get_init()
S
64 2 10
plugin_row_meta()
S
68 2 7
find_user_by_code()
S
70 2 5
webHookURL()
S
65 2 8
get_option()
S
78 2 3
check_ssl()
S
72 2 5
settings_tab()
S
75 1 4
update_option()
S
70 1 6
excerpt_more()
S
81 1 3
dropdown_filter()
S
76 1 4
button_data_check()
S
78 1 3
user_field()
S
81 1 3
get_admin_path()
S
67 1 7
menu()
S
75 1 4
after_settings_updated_message()
S
75 1 4
login_action()
S
82 1 3